How long does tattoo removal take?
Within 2 to 3 laser treatments, tattoos and cuts will fade away. The removal method differs from one individual to the next and is dependent on a variety of factors.
- Skin type assessment (Fitzpatrick Skin type)
- Testing the tattoo for layering (is the tattoo a cover-up one)
- The location or position of a tattoo on your body may determine how long it takes to remove or fade away.
- The amount of ink used is also a factor (the more colourful the tattoo, the longer it will take)
- If there is pre-existing scarring, extra care and time will be required.
As a result, the average time and amount of laser sessions needed for tattoo removal are dictated by the tattoo and body conditions.

Tattoo Removal Side Effects:
These are the side effects of tattoo removal; frankly speaking, you can’t even consider these as side effects. They are insignificant for tiny tattoos.
- Skin redness is very popular.
- Patients report tenderness during tattoo removal treatments.
- Swelling is common, mainly if the tattoo is larger.
- Blistering occurs, but it subsides after 48 hours.
- Mild injuries that recover within 3 to 5 days
- If the tattoo is abnormally large, such as on the backside of the neck, the stomach, or the whole arm, it may induce pigmentation for a few weeks.
